PARENT CONSULTATION

Raising a child can be one of the most rewarding — and most challenging — things a person can do. Children don’t come with an instruction manual and you may have no idea how to support your child through challenging times. Parent consultation sessions offer a dedicated space for you, without your child present, to collaborate and reflect on what's coming up at home, discuss your child's progress, and explore strategies to better support them in their day to day life. The goal is to deepen your understanding of your child and feel more confident supporting them beyond the therapy room.

These sessions can also be a space to process, reflect, and explore your own experience of being a parent and how your experiences of being parented show up in interactions with your child.

Consultations are offered virtually and in-person. They are not required even if a child is currently engaged in therapeutic treatment but are strongly recommended as the primary way to maintain involvement in your child’s care.
